Veterans commonly experience back pain, often stemming from back injuries during military service. Join us as we take you through the most common VA claims for back pain, which specific conditions are most prevalent among Veterans, and how these back conditions are rated for Veterans' benefits. Is Sciatica a form of radiculopathy? Or is that separate condition?
@CCK_Law
@CCK_Law Ай бұрын
Hello! Yes it is a form of radiculopathy. And yes sciatic nerve conditions do have their own diagnostic codes! The sciatic nerve is rated under diagnostic codes 8520, 8620, and 8720. Have a great day!

Does Degenerative disc disease and degenerative arthritis have the same diagnostic code 5242?
@CCK_Law
@CCK_Law 3 ай бұрын
Hello! Degenerative disc disease and degenerative arthritis are both assigned the same diagnostic code, which is 5242, in the VA benefits system. Check out our blog on degenerative disc disease here: cck-law.com/blog/va-disability-ratings-for-degenerative-disc-disease/ Have a great day!
